Tri-Rivers culinary student wins award

Tri-Rivers culinary student Andrew Hebauf, left, holds a certificate with Tri-Rivers culinary arts instructor Lance Stalnaker, right, which marks the highest score ever achieved by a high school student at the 9th Annual Roland E. Schaeffer Culinary Classic in Port Huron, Michigan. Hebauf also competed with the Tri-Rivers Culinary Team at the American Culinary Federation Northeast Regional Championships, where the team earned a Bronze Medal together.
